A Place Set Apart
The name The Cherith comes from the biblical account of Elijah in 1 Kings 17. During a difficult and uncertain season, the Lord told Elijah: “Get thee hence, and turn thee eastward, and hide thyself by the brook Cherith…” — 1 Kings 17:3
There, away from everything familiar, God provided for Elijah. He gave him water from the brook and sent ravens to bring him food. It was a hidden place—a place where the Lord provided all that Elijah needed. That picture is at the heart of The Cherith.
We believe there are times when we all need to come away from the noise and demands of everyday life—to be still, seek the Lord, listen for His voice, and allow Him to refresh us. Our prayer is that The Cherith is your place of rest, renewal, and restoration as you seek the Lord.

The Lodge
The main Lodge provides a comfortable gathering place for fellowship, meals, Bible studies, worship, meetings, teaching, and ministry events. It includes two fully equipped kitchens, two bathrooms, a large open meeting and fellowship area, two sitting areas, a pool table, game table, and bunk room. Additional tables and chairs are available to accommodate groups.

Things To Do

Adventure awaits around every corner! Enjoy wildlife viewing where you can spot majestic Red Stags, Black Bucks, Axis, and Fallow Deer in their natural habitat. Our peaceful lakes offer an array of activities including canoeing, kayaking, paddle boating, and fishing. Plus, our scenic hiking trails provide the perfect backdrop for exploration. And don’t forget to take a dip in our indoor swimming pool – ideal for relaxation any time of the year!

Our Story
The Cherith is a secluded place. A place away from the world and the busyness of life. It’s a place that God provided for us to walk into. God provided all the provisions for us to fulfill what He put into our heart.
"Cherith" means a cutting away. For us we believe that productive “cutting” happens when we are away with our Father, the vinedresser. The Vinedresser cuts away nonproductive branches. John 15:1-27 teaches that there is a place and time for God to prepare you for what He has next.
He is ready to speak to you, are you ready to stop your busyness to hear His voice? He calls you away to speak tenderly to you and it’s not in the wind, fire or earthquake…it’s in a gentle whisper.
